As we embrace a posture of companionship in the global church, an Anabaptist group called Iziko Lamaqabane in South Africa is stepping up to that commitment and offering to walk with us. In addition to their ministry of working with urban peace and justice practitioners in South Africa to “heal colonial wounds, disrupt systemic violence and cultivate faith formed by and expressed in liberative praxis”, the Iziko leaders are gifted in facilitating pilgrimage learning experiences. It is their conviction that “the more we can walk together, sharing stories, friendship and knowledge, the more our wisdom, longevity and capacity to disrupt violence and oppression will grow.”
How can we, as Anabaptists in Canada, learn in solidarity with our sisters and brothers in South Africa, assuming a posture of deep listening, paying careful attention to those whose struggle is the greatest, and discerning our response in community?
Mennonite Church Canada is working in partnership with Iziko Lama to explore the long history and legacy of colonialism and apartheid in South Africa in the form of a pilgrimage. For more information:
